About Fotor Photo Restoration
What is Fotor Photo Restoration? Fotor Photo Restoration is a specialized AI-powered tool designed to automatically revive old, damaged, and low-quality photos. The tool addresses common issues such as scratches, tears, and noise, while enhancing fine image details. It relies on deep learning algorithms to colorize black-and-white photos and improve facial clarity, making it a comprehensive solution for both casual users and professionals. The tool aims to deliver fast, high-quality repairs without the need for advanced technical expertise. Key Features and Capabilities Fotor Photo Restoration stands out for its ability to fully automate the photo restoration process, saving significant time and effort compared to manual methods. The tool accurately analyzes the image to identify damaged areas, then applies advanced techniques to remove defects and restore missing details. Its support for colorizing black-and-white photos adds a new dimension to historical images, making them appear more vibrant and realistic. AI-Powered Scratch and Tear Removal: The tool automatically detects and removes scratches, tears, and surface imperfections from photos, intelligently reconstructing missing parts while preserving the consistency of the original image. Automatic Black-and-White Photo Colorization: It uses deep learning algorithms to add natural and realistic colors to old photos, taking into account context and details such as skin tone, clothing, and backgrounds. Facial Enhancement and Detail Sharpening: The tool improves the clarity of facial features, such as eyes and mouth, and removes blur, making portrait photos appear cleaner and sharper. Noise Reduction and Blur Correction: It reduces digital noise resulting from poor lighting or low image quality, and corrects blurry photos to restore detail sharpness. Batch Processing for Multiple Photos: This feature allows users to upload and process several photos at once, increasing productivity and saving time, especially when dealing with large albums. Tips for Best Results To get the best results from Fotor Photo Restoration, it is recommended to upload photos at the highest available resolution, as low-resolution images may limit the tool's ability to restore fine details. It is also advisable to experiment with different tool settings on a single photo first to understand their effect before applying them to an entire set of images. Finally, use the batch processing feature after adjusting optimal settings to save time when working on large albums. What Sets Fotor Photo Restoration Apart? AI Tools Oasis Team Review: Fotor Photo Restoration
Fotor Photo Restoration Review: The AI Tools Oasis team has comprehensively tested and reviewed this tool. Here is our detailed assessment. 🎯 Overview Fotor Photo Restoration is an AI tool specialized in restoring old and damaged photos. It automatically removes scratches, tears, and noise while enhancing details. The tool relies on deep learning algorithms to colorize black-and-white photos and improve facial clarity, making it a practical choice for both casual users and professionals seeking quick, high-quality photo repair solutions. ✅ Strengths What impressed our team most about this tool is its ability to combine multiple functions in one platform, from removing scratches and tears to automatically colorizing old photos. The face enhancement feature works remarkably well to restore facial features in faded photos, positively impacting the quality of the final outputs. Additionally, the batch processing capability saves significant time for users with large archives of old photos, making the tool suitable for large projects without needing to repeat the process manually for each image. ⚙️ User Experience In practice, getting started with Fotor Photo Restoration was very smooth. You can upload an image directly from your device or via a link, and the tool automatically analyzes it within seconds. We noticed that the learning curve is nearly nonexistent; the interface is simple and includes clear options such as "Restore" and "Colorize." In a typical task of restoring an old family photo from the 1950s, the tool successfully removed most white lines and scratches, restored colors naturally, and improved facial clarity. The output quality was very satisfactory, especially for photos that do not require complex manual adjustments. ⚠️ Notes and Improvements Despite its good performance, we noticed that the tool may struggle with severely damaged photos or those with large missing areas, potentially producing some distortions in reconstructed regions. Also, the free version has certain limits on the number of photos and processing quality, which may prompt professional users to subscribe to a paid plan for better results. We hope future updates will include more precise manual control options for advanced users. 👥 Best Suited For (And Who It May Not Suit) This tool is ideal for amateur photographers and family members who want to restore their old photos quickly without technical complications. It also suits historians and researchers who need to improve the quality of historical images. On the other hand, it may not be the best choice for professionals who require pixel-level control or for projects needing complex restoration of severely damaged photos, as they may need specialized tools like Photoshop with AI plugins. 💡 Final Verdict The AI Tools Oasis team recommends using Fotor Photo Restoration as a reliable daily tool for restoring old photos, especially for users who prefer quick solutions with acceptable quality without needing technical expertise. The tool offers excellent value for the price in the free trial version, while paid plans provide broader capabilities for more demanding users. If you are looking for a balance between ease of use and quality in photo restoration, this tool is worth trying.

Pricing Information
Freemium
Offers a free plan with 3 low-resolution restorations and watermarks. Paid plans start at $8.99/month for Pro (unlimited high-res restorations, no watermarks) and $19.99/month for Pro+ (batch processing and priority support).
